Origins & Craftsmanship

Produced by Billecart-Salmon, one of Champagne’s most respected family-owned houses, the Vintage 2018 Brut reflects a house style centered on precision, finesse, and extended aging.

The 2018 vintage was warm and expressive, delivering ripe fruit balanced by freshness when handled with restraint. Vinification is carried out in stainless steel to preserve purity, followed by extended lees aging to build texture, integration, and complexity.

The blend is based on the classic Champagne varieties—Pinot Noir, Chardonnay, and Pinot Meunier—sourced from carefully selected vineyards across the region, resulting in a wine that balances fruit richness with mineral structure.

The magnum format (1.5L) is significant:
– Slower aging due to lower oxygen exposure
– Greater aromatic integration over time
– Enhanced texture and longevity

Combined with the “1776–2026” 250th Anniversary commemorative label, this becomes both a drinking wine and a collectible statement piece.


Tasting Profile

Nose:
Lemon zest, white peach, brioche, and delicate floral notes

Palate:
Round and refined, with citrus, orchard fruit, and a fine, persistent mousse

Finish:
Clean, balanced, and mineral-driven, with long, elegant persistence
